The word "seamless" gets thrown around a lot in technology demos. But I don't think I've ever seen a better example of the concept than in Monday's keynote at Apple's Worldwide Developers Conference, when senior vice president Craig Federighi showed Handoff — part of the new "Continuity" feature in iOS 8 and OS X Yosemite.
Handoff lets you begin a task on an iPhone, then pick up right where you were on another device that's close by. You start composing an email on your iPhone and — presumably when you realize you have more to say than you thought — you put it down and pull out your Mac, resuming right where you left off by clicking one button.
